Transition Networks TN-SFP-10G-D-10 10G Single Mode SFP Module

The Transition Networks TN-SFP-10G-D-10 is a 10 Gigabit Ethernet SFP transceiver module designed for long-distance backbone and campus network deployments. Single-mode fiber optic construction enables extended transmission distances critical for carrier-grade and enterprise-scale security and surveillance infrastructure. This module integrates into any standard managed switch with available SFP slots, providing dense 10G connectivity without dedicated line-card modules. For security integrators deploying multi-site video surveillance, distributed access control, or campus-wide IP-based systems, the TN-SFP-10G-D-10 eliminates bandwidth bottlenecks on the backbone while maintaining the cost efficiency of modular optics.

Long-distance single-mode deployments are the backbone of distributed security systems. On a 500-meter separation between two buildings, multimode fiber introduces signal degradation and requires active regeneration; single-mode fiber preserves signal integrity over kilometers without repeaters. The TN-SFP-10G-D-10 pairs optical reach with 10G line-rate throughput, so you can consolidate multiple video streams (8-16 HD IP cameras per campus node) onto a single fiber pair. This is particularly valuable in retrofit scenarios where existing conduit capacity is limited — one fiber run replaces what might otherwise require four multimode strands.

From a total-cost-of-ownership perspective, SFP modules are far cheaper to upgrade or replace than switching entire line cards or chassis. If a 10G fiber module fails on a 48-port managed switch, you swap the module ($500-1500) rather than the entire $8,000-12,000 switch. On multi-year security system lifecycles, that modularity compounds into measurable savings. We've installed hundreds of SFP-based backbone links across security networks, and single-mode fiber is the unsung workhorse of large-scale deployments. The TN-SFP-10G-D-10 sits in a sweet spot: it's a commodity transceiver (meaning repair shops carry spares), it integrates into any standards-compliant managed switch, and it gives you genuinely long reach without the latency or capex footprint of active regeneration. On a recent 2.5-km campus perimeter project, we ran one fiber pair from the central NVR facility to a remote analog-to-IP gateway in a far security house. Multimode would have required a repeater station halfway (added complexity, power draw, and failure points); single-mode fiber let us run direct, no repeaters. The TN-SFP-10G-D-10 paired with a Cisco managed switch at each end handled 16 HD camera streams plus redundant VLAN traffic for badge readers without any congestion or retransmission. That's the real value proposition — simplicity and reach, not just speed.

Deployment Considerations:

  • Fiber Plant Quality Matters: A single speck of dust on an LC connector will kill the link. Require any contractor installing this module to use dust caps on all fiber jumpers and to clean terminations with alcohol and lens paper before connection. We've seen sites blame the SFP module for a $5 fiber-cleanliness issue.
  • Managed Switch Requirement: This is an SFP module — it only works in switches with available SFP slots. Verify your target switch has open SFP ports (not all switch models support every SFP flavor, though 10G SFP is standard on any modern managed switch). Older PoE-only industrial switches may not have SFP slots at all.
  • Distance Certification: Single-mode fiber over 10 km requires careful attenuation budgeting. If you're pushing the distance limits, test the link with an optical multimeter before final installation. Transition Networks provides attenuation specs in the datasheet — match fiber loss + connector loss against those budgets.
  • Redundancy Strategy: A single fiber link is a single point of failure. For critical backbone connections (NVR to remote gateway, for example), run dual fiber pairs to the same destination and configure RSTP or LACP on the switch to automatically failover. The TN-SFP-10G-D-10 cost per link is low enough that redundancy is cost-justified on critical paths.
  • Uplink vs. Downlink Role: This module is agnostic about direction — it works equally well as an uplink from a remote access point as it does as a downlink into a central switch. Plan your fiber topology (star, mesh, ring) before purchasing — that drives how many modules you need and which switch ports they occupy.
